在数字时代的今天,信息安全已经成为每个人都需要关注的重要议题。而在这其中,区块链技术以其独特的密码学原理,成为了守护信息安全的重要防线。本文将带你揭开区块链密码学的神秘面纱,了解其如何成为加密守护者的核心。
一、区块链与密码学的渊源
区块链,作为一项颠覆性的技术创新,其核心组成部分之一就是密码学。密码学是研究如何将信息转换为难以理解的形式,从而保护信息不被未授权访问的科学。区块链技术正是利用了密码学中的多种算法来确保数据的安全和不可篡改性。
1. 非对称加密
非对称加密是区块链技术中最为核心的密码学原理之一。它使用一对密钥:公钥和私钥。公钥可以公开,用于加密信息;而私钥则需要保密,用于解密信息。这种加密方式保证了即使公钥被公开,信息的安全性也不会受到影响。
2. 摩尔曼加密
摩尔曼加密是区块链中另一种重要的加密算法,它利用了密码学中的哈希函数。哈希函数可以将任意长度的数据转换为固定长度的字符串,这个过程是不可逆的,即无法从哈希值反推出原始数据。这使得摩尔曼加密在验证数据完整性和真实性方面具有重要作用。
二、区块链密码学的应用
区块链技术在密码学的基础上,实现了以下应用:
1. 数据加密
在区块链中,所有交易数据都需要经过加密处理。通过非对称加密和摩尔曼加密,确保了交易数据在传输过程中的安全。
2. 身份认证
区块链技术可以利用密码学原理实现用户身份的验证。通过公钥和私钥的配对,可以确保用户身份的唯一性和安全性。
3. 数据不可篡改
由于区块链的分布式特性,任何一条数据一旦被添加到区块链中,就几乎无法被篡改。这是基于密码学中的哈希算法和共识机制实现的。
三、区块链密码学的挑战与未来
尽管区块链密码学在保障信息安全方面取得了显著成果,但仍然面临着一些挑战:
1. 密钥管理
密钥是区块链安全的关键,如何安全地管理和存储密钥,防止密钥泄露,是当前亟待解决的问题。
2. 攻击手段
随着区块链技术的发展,攻击者可能会找到新的攻击手段,如量子计算对现有加密算法的威胁。
3. 法律法规
区块链技术的快速发展需要相应的法律法规来规范,以确保其安全、合规地应用。
未来,区块链密码学将继续发挥其重要作用,有望在以下几个方面取得突破:
1. 新型加密算法
随着量子计算的发展,现有的加密算法可能会面临挑战。因此,开发新型加密算法是区块链密码学的重要方向。
2. 跨链互操作性
区块链之间需要实现更好的互操作性,以促进不同区块链之间的数据共享和交易。
3. 安全性提升
随着技术的进步,区块链密码学的安全性将得到进一步提升,为用户提供更加可靠的信息安全保障。
通过本文的介绍,相信大家对区块链密码学有了更深入的了解。在数字时代,掌握区块链密码学的知识,将有助于我们更好地应对信息安全的挑战。
